Transaction 024951a8c6d942849395424e76343c105bf571553135189be95a9faef7e6de51

1 Input
2 Outputs
  • 024951a8c6d942849395424e76343c105bf571553135189be95a9faef7e6de51:0
  • value  29960000
    address  36pX9VdcWwj2MoKGQbRgZt7GpUJhxPH5XR
  • 024951a8c6d942849395424e76343c105bf571553135189be95a9faef7e6de51:1
  • value  367501712
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n